Service history
Do Citroen keep a centralised service history, i.e., I have a C5 with no history although it seems to have been well maintained, can I hope to get its history from a Citroen dealer. G.

I was lucky when I bought my year 2001 Xantia in mid 2009.
It was a one-owner, always serviced by the same main dealer.
I got it from an independent dealer who had been passed it from a main dealer. Too old for the main dealer's forecourt, I suppose.
This independent dealer is on good terms with the main dealer and so was able to get a full print-out of all work done since the car was new.
Two things this print-out showed were:
how expensive main dealer routine servicing is
how much service replacement is over-the-top (eg 8 new pollen filters at £26 or so each in 8 years and a total mileage of 36100).
The last service, at 36100 miles in April 2009, mentions that the garage considered the clutch to need replacing. I guess the associated costs were too much for the owner, who traded the car in. It's now at 66000 miles and the clutch, never changed, is fine. Perhaps I'd better touch wood!).

A Citroen dealer will only be able to tell you what servicing has been done at main dealers. Often is the case that when cars reach 3 years old they fall out of dealer servicing and go to independents, which is no bad thing.
